Mätkrets - testa dimmer
Postat: 25 mars 2011, 11:40:57
Hejsan!
Jag har ett problem som jag hoppas kunna få lite hjälp med här. Jag och några till bygger en robot som ska slitagetesta en dimmer. Vi har en linjärmotor som trycker på dimmern och en stegmotor som vrider på dimmern. Vi har Arduino som microkontroller och det funkar jättebra att köra motorerna. Tanken är att vi ska starta dimmern genom att trycka en gång med linjärmotorn och sedan vrida x antal steg med stegmotorn och sedan mäta spänningen för att se så att dimmern fungerar korrekt och fortsätta vrida upp dimmern tills den når max och mäta vid flera mätpunkter under uppvridandet. För att mäta detta har vi gjort en liten mätkrets:
Den sista lilla kretsen i bilden är en RMS - DC omvandlare och det är tänkt att när vi vrider på dimmern ändras RMS - värdet på signalen och den omvandlar det till DC som vi kör in i Arduino - kortet som mäter spänningen. Arduino kortet tål 0 - 5 V in och vi kommer få mellan 0 och nästan 1 V eftersom RMS - DC omvandlaren inte klarar mer. Det värdet mellan 0 - 5 V omvandlar Arduino kortet till ett värde mellan 0 - 1063 (ungefär inte helt säker).
Vi har kopplat kretsen på en liten kopplingsbräda och testat med en signalgenerator för att testa så att den fungerar som den ska och det funkar utmärkt. Problemet är nu när vi ska koppla in 230 V nätspänning. För det första så vet vi ju inte vilken som är fas och vilken som är nolla. Vi har en grendosa vi ska sätta inne i roboten så vi kan ju sätta kontakten på ett sätt i väggen och sedan på ett annat sätt i grendosan. Vi vet inte hur vi ska avgöra vilken som är fas och vilken som är nolla. Någon som vet hur vi ska lösa detta? Dessutom undrar jag om det kommer märkas tillräckligt mycket på signalen när man dimmrar den så att kretsen känner av den förändringen? Jag är inte så haj på hur mycket en dimmer justerar signalen. Men det mest akuta problemet är att vi inte vet vilken som är fas och vilken som är nolla så vi är rädda att göra sönder till exempel vår RMS - DC omvandlare. Någon som vet hur vi ska lösa detta samt har några andra bra idéer eller tips på hur vi ska tillväga med den här roboten?
Så här är det tänkt att roboten ska se ut på ett ungefär så ni får en bild av hur roboten ska se ut och gå tillväga när den vrider på dimmern. Sedan undrar jag också om ni tror det är bättre att placera stegmotorn direkt på linjärmotorn? Så när man kör med linjärmotorn så trycks stegmotorn mot dimmern. Eller om man ska göra som vi gjort och separera dem för vi tänkte att stegmotorn kanske blir dålig om den ska utsättas för tryck hela tiden? Eller vad tror ni? Tacksam för svar! Tack på förhand!
Mikael
Jag har ett problem som jag hoppas kunna få lite hjälp med här. Jag och några till bygger en robot som ska slitagetesta en dimmer. Vi har en linjärmotor som trycker på dimmern och en stegmotor som vrider på dimmern. Vi har Arduino som microkontroller och det funkar jättebra att köra motorerna. Tanken är att vi ska starta dimmern genom att trycka en gång med linjärmotorn och sedan vrida x antal steg med stegmotorn och sedan mäta spänningen för att se så att dimmern fungerar korrekt och fortsätta vrida upp dimmern tills den når max och mäta vid flera mätpunkter under uppvridandet. För att mäta detta har vi gjort en liten mätkrets:
Den sista lilla kretsen i bilden är en RMS - DC omvandlare och det är tänkt att när vi vrider på dimmern ändras RMS - värdet på signalen och den omvandlar det till DC som vi kör in i Arduino - kortet som mäter spänningen. Arduino kortet tål 0 - 5 V in och vi kommer få mellan 0 och nästan 1 V eftersom RMS - DC omvandlaren inte klarar mer. Det värdet mellan 0 - 5 V omvandlar Arduino kortet till ett värde mellan 0 - 1063 (ungefär inte helt säker).
Vi har kopplat kretsen på en liten kopplingsbräda och testat med en signalgenerator för att testa så att den fungerar som den ska och det funkar utmärkt. Problemet är nu när vi ska koppla in 230 V nätspänning. För det första så vet vi ju inte vilken som är fas och vilken som är nolla. Vi har en grendosa vi ska sätta inne i roboten så vi kan ju sätta kontakten på ett sätt i väggen och sedan på ett annat sätt i grendosan. Vi vet inte hur vi ska avgöra vilken som är fas och vilken som är nolla. Någon som vet hur vi ska lösa detta? Dessutom undrar jag om det kommer märkas tillräckligt mycket på signalen när man dimmrar den så att kretsen känner av den förändringen? Jag är inte så haj på hur mycket en dimmer justerar signalen. Men det mest akuta problemet är att vi inte vet vilken som är fas och vilken som är nolla så vi är rädda att göra sönder till exempel vår RMS - DC omvandlare. Någon som vet hur vi ska lösa detta samt har några andra bra idéer eller tips på hur vi ska tillväga med den här roboten?
Så här är det tänkt att roboten ska se ut på ett ungefär så ni får en bild av hur roboten ska se ut och gå tillväga när den vrider på dimmern. Sedan undrar jag också om ni tror det är bättre att placera stegmotorn direkt på linjärmotorn? Så när man kör med linjärmotorn så trycks stegmotorn mot dimmern. Eller om man ska göra som vi gjort och separera dem för vi tänkte att stegmotorn kanske blir dålig om den ska utsättas för tryck hela tiden? Eller vad tror ni? Tacksam för svar! Tack på förhand!
Mikael